Output 59db90bd8e6527780c31dfa7d55ea3fff159e8b3a367618a6335e0258f93d6bc:8

value
88554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f36e8da6f08531694c8367b5ee5d6b571be165d5 OP_EQUAL
address
3PtAZYBgvsLmP1fVs3iYkVuy7G9JNThXCM
transaction
59db90bd8e6527780c31dfa7d55ea3fff159e8b3a367618a6335e0258f93d6bc
spent
true